Mini Warehouse Self-Storage Roll Up Garage Door Springs - 0.218x3.375 Custom SizeOur replacement Mini Warehouse Springs use a Class 11 oil tempered wire with a heat treated coating to resist rust. We can produce Torsion Springs for most Roll Up Door Manufactures including: DBCI Doors, Janus Doors, Betco Doors, Trac Rite Doors, Porvene Doors, B&D Doors, Steel Line Doors and more. Standard Features: High tensile Oil tempered Corrosion resistant Long cycle life Meet ASTM A229 Standard PICKUP NOT AVAILABLE, STANDARD PRODUCTION AND
